Peter Lynch
Peter Lynch is a legendary investor and former manager of the Magellan Fund at Fidelity Investments, known for his successful investment strategies that emphasize investing in what you know. He believes that individual investors can achieve significant success by thoroughly researching and understanding the companies they invest in. Lynch is also a bestselling author, with popular books like 'One Up on Wall Street' and 'Beating the Street,' which provide insights into his investment philosophy and stock selection strategies. His approach focuses on long-term investments and the importance of patience, knowledge, and discipline in navigating the stock market.
